There are lots of treatment options for asthma, but it’s important to keep in mind that asthma is a chronic condition, so treatment involves managing the symptoms of asthma. A patient with allergic asthma may benefit from allergy testing that can reveal allergens to avoid, like pet dander or dust. For a patient like that and for other patients, treatment could entail:
• Home use of an air conditioner/dehumidifier
• Using a controller medication to help prevent asthma attacks
• A prescription for and use of a rescue inhaler for asthma attacks
• Use of a nebulizer instead of an inhaler
• Vaccinations for influenza and pneumonia, conditions that can trigger flare-ups
• Allergy medications for allergic asthma
• Allergy immunotherapy for allergic asthma in some cases
• Immediate care at an urgent care clinic or at the ER (emergency room) when necessary
The best treatment is a comprehensive one that includes many of the treatments above and a long-term plan for symptom management.
Please remember that if a situation is or could be life-threatening, the only option for treatment is to call 911 and go to the ER. So long as the situation is non-life-threatening, and for the long-term treatment of asthma, go see a doctor, like an urgent care doctor. Generally, you should see a physician or urgent care doctor when:
• There are any changes to your symptoms
• Your asthma isn’t controlled properly-currently
• You have a minor flare-up and want professional care
• You have a minor asthma attack and you’re sure it’s only minor
• You want to change your approach to dealing with your asthma, like trying allergy immunotherapy
